Rutland County
Chartered: October 12, 1761
Area: 27,811 Acres = 43.45 Square Miles
Population (US Census, 2000): 3,140
Population Density (persons per square mile): 72.3

Pittsford Vermont is located north of Rutland, along RT 7, in Central Vermont. The town features a golf course and country club, a marble museum, and even a castle. The Vermont State Police Academy is also located in town, lending a certain added measure of security to its residents.
